#b29dbc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b29dbc is composed of 69.8% red, 61.6%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 16.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 280.6 degrees, a saturation of 18.8% and a lightness of 67.6%. #b29db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#653b79.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#b29dbc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060507 is the darkest color, while #fbfafc is the lightest one.
